17年英語(yǔ)TEM八級(jí)考試改錯(cuò)部分復(fù)習(xí)指導(dǎo)試題

  part 1

  Demographic indicators show that Americans in the post war period were more eager than ever to establish families. They quickly brought down the age at marriage for both men and women and brought the birth rate to a twentieth century height __1__after more than a hundred years of a steady decline, producing the “baby boom.” __2__These young adults established a trend of early marriage and relatively large families that went for more than two decades and caused a major but temporary __3__reversal of long-term demographic patterns. From the 1940s through the early 1960s, Americans married at a high rate and at a ounger age than their __4__Europe counterparts. __5__Less noted but equally more significant, the men and women who formed __6__families between 1940 and 1960 nevertheless reduced the divorce rate after a __7__postwar peak; their marriages remained intact to a greater extent than did that of __8__couples who married in earlier as well as later decades. Since the United States __9__maintained its dubious distinction of having the highest divorce rate in the world,the temporary decline in divorce did not occur in the same extent in Europe. __10__Contrary to fears of the experts, the role of breadwinner and homemaker was not abandoned.

  答案:

  1 將height改為high/peak。整句話的大意為他們把男女的婚齡降了下來(lái),使出生率達(dá)到了20世紀(jì)的高峰。high可以用作名詞,意為“高峰”,“高水準(zhǔn)”,“最高紀(jì)錄”。height可以作“極點(diǎn),頂點(diǎn)”解釋。例如:The height of cleverness is to conceal one’s cleverness。

  2 將第二個(gè)不定冠詞a 去掉。steady decline 意為持續(xù)的下降,前面不用加冠詞。又如:years of hard work。根據(jù)語(yǔ)感可以判斷出來(lái)。

  3 在went后加on,或?qū)ent改為lasted。此處是“持續(xù)”的意思,所以可以用went on 或者last來(lái)表達(dá)。

  4 將high改為higher。此處意為美國(guó)人結(jié)婚率比以前提高了,有與戰(zhàn)前相比的意思,因此應(yīng)用比較級(jí)。

  5將Europe改為European。

  6 刪掉more。此處的大意為戰(zhàn)后離婚率也下降了,這個(gè)現(xiàn)象不大有人注意,但同樣也很重要。另外,more與equally相矛盾。

  7 將nevertheless改為also或者刪掉nevertheless。此處上下文之間不是轉(zhuǎn)折關(guān)系,而是遞進(jìn)關(guān)系。

  8 將that 改為those。此處的'代詞應(yīng)指marriages這個(gè)復(fù)數(shù)名詞,因此應(yīng)用those。此處考察代詞與先行詞一致的問(wèn)題。

  9將Since改為Although/Though/While。此處是轉(zhuǎn)折關(guān)系,不是因果關(guān)系。

  10 將in改為to。短語(yǔ)to the extent是固定搭配。

  part 2

  When you start talking about good and bad manners you immediately start meeting difficulties. Many people just cannot agree what they mean. We asked a

  lady, who replied that she thought you could tell a well-mannered person on the __1__way they occupied the space around them—for example, when such a person walks down a street he or she is constantly unaware of others. Such people never __2__bump into other people.However, a second person thought that this was more a question of civilized behavior as good manners. Instead, this other person told us a story, __3__it he said was quite well-known, about an American who had been invited __4__to an Arab meal at one of the countries of the Middle East. The American __5__hasn’t been told very much about the kind of food he might expect. If he had __6__known about American food, he might have behaved better. __7__Immediately before him was a very flat piece of bread that looked, to him, very much as a napkin. Picking it up, he put it into his collar, so that __8__it falls across his shirt. His Arab host, who had been watching, __9__said of nothing, but immediately copied the action of his guest. __10__And that, said this second person, was a fine example of good manners.

  答案如下:

  1將on改為by。“by the way”作“根據(jù)……方式”講。

  2 將unaware改為aware.根據(jù)下文中的“Such a person never bump into other people”判斷,這種人不會(huì)“目中無(wú)人”。

  3 將as改為than.“more + adj/of + n + than”是固定搭配。

  4 將it改為which.which在此引導(dǎo)一個(gè)非限制性定語(yǔ)從句,which在從句中作主語(yǔ),需要注意的`是,在從句中he said是插入語(yǔ)。

  5 將at改為in.名詞the country前要用介詞in。

  6 將hasn’t改為hadn’t.根據(jù)上下文我們可以看出這里需要使用過(guò)去完成時(shí)。

  7 將American改為Arab。根據(jù)上文,我們可以看出,這里講述的是赴“阿拉伯”傳統(tǒng)宴會(huì)的“美國(guó)人”的故事,而不是赴“美國(guó)”傳統(tǒng)宴會(huì)的“美國(guó)人”的故事。

  8 將as 改為like.介詞as意思為“作為”,like意思為“像”。

  9 將falls改為fell.這里要使用一般過(guò)去時(shí)。

  10 將第一個(gè)of刪掉。say作為及物動(dòng)詞,后面可直接跟名詞作賓語(yǔ)。
